Oncogene expression from extrachromosomal DNA is driven by copy number amplification and does not require spatial clustering
2022-01-29
Abstract excerpt
<h4>Summary</h4> Extrachromosomal DNA (ecDNA) are frequently observed in human cancers and are responsible for high levels of oncogene expression. In glioblastoma (GBM), ecDNA copy number correlates with poor prognosis.
